diagnose-build-failure support to check for specific failure messages
Bug: 161807948
Test: ALLOW_MISSING_PROJECTS=true ./development/diagnose-build-failure/diagnose-build-failure.sh --message "Cannot convert the provided notation to a File or URI: camera-extensions-stub.jar" "-PverifyUpToDate docs-fake:lintVitalPublicRelease"
Change-Id: Ib3788708546fd29ce6fae1e35d00aa82d3a73358
